**Core Concept**
The patient's symptoms suggest a chronic immunodeficiency disorder, likely due to a defect in the phagocytic system. Chronic infections with Pseudomonas aeruginosa, particularly in the respiratory tract, are characteristic of chronic granulomatous disease (CGD).
**Why the Correct Answer is Right**
The patient's condition is consistent with chronic granulomatous disease (CGD), a genetic disorder caused by mutations in the genes encoding components of the NADPH oxidase complex. This complex is essential for the production of superoxide, a key antimicrobial agent produced by phagocytes. In CGD, the NADPH oxidase complex is defective, leading to impaired superoxide production and increased susceptibility to catalase-positive bacteria, such as Pseudomonas aeruginosa. The use of IFN-γ (Interferon-gamma) can improve the patient's condition by enhancing the antimicrobial activity of macrophages and neutrophils.

**Clinical Pearl / High-Yield Fact**
Chronic granulomatous disease (CGD) is a rare genetic disorder characterized by recurrent infections with catalase-positive bacteria, particularly Pseudomonas aeruginosa. The use of IFN-γ can improve the antimicrobial activity of phagocytes and is a key component of the management of CGD.
